<title>Repair widespread misuse of _PyString_Resize.  Since it's clear people</title>
<updated>2002-04-27T18:44:32+00:00</updated>
<author>
<name>Tim Peters</name>
<email>tim.peters@gmail.com</email>
</author>
<published>2002-04-27T18:44:32+00:00</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://git.baserock.org/cgit/delta/cpython-git.git/commit/?id=5de9842b34cbefbfe74e6a99004616352f223133'/>
<id>5de9842b34cbefbfe74e6a99004616352f223133</id>
<content type='text'>
don't understand how this function works, also beefed up the docs.  The
most common usage error is of this form (often spread out across gotos):

	if (_PyString_Resize(&amp;s, n) &lt; 0) {
		Py_DECREF(s);
		s = NULL;
		goto outtahere;
	}

The error is that if _PyString_Resize runs out of memory, it automatically
decrefs the input string object s (which also deallocates it, since its
refcount must be 1 upon entry), and sets s to NULL.  So if the "if"
branch ever triggers, it's an error to call Py_DECREF(s):  s is already
NULL!  A correct way to write the above is the simpler (and intended)

	if (_PyString_Resize(&amp;s, n) &lt; 0)
		goto outtahere;

Bugfix candidate.
